Poll: Trump Leads Rubio By 18
Points Nationwide Post-Debate
thehill.com ^
| February 26
Posted on 02/26/2016 4:50:23 PM PST by Helicondelta
Donald Trump leads Sen. Marco Rubio (R-Fla.) by 18 points nationwide after the tenth GOP presidential debate, according to a new survey.
Trump roars past Rubio with 39 percent to 21 percent, according to the NBC News/Survey Monkey poll released Friday.
